It depends on what you want from it - You could get some information
from it via the Package class, e.g.
public String getVersion()
{
String implVersion = null;
Package pkg = this.getClass().getPackage();
if (pkg != null)
{
implVersion = pkg.getImplementationVersion();
}
return Strings.isEmpty(implVersion) ? "n/a" : implVersion;
}
See the java.lang.Package for more info. Beyond that though, I think
you'll have to address the manifest.mf specifically - I'd not have
expected a resource to find it easily...
